After Yves Klein's "Winged Victory" from 1962, which in turn was based on the ancient Greek sculpture "Victoire de Samothrace" from 190 BC. The massive original has been exhibited at the top of the main staircase in the Louvre Museum in Paris since 1884.
KA$M's large unique piece reflects Klein's work and the fact that the figure represented is the Greek goddess of victory, known as Nike. The Nike sportswear company named itself after the goddess, seeking association with victory. Their "swoosh" logo has been added to the plinth.
Stunning large hand-painted plaster sculpture in a remarkably intense shade of blue, incorporating KA$M's trademark humour and depth. Measuring 16" x 12" x 8" and weighing 1.2kg, this is a unique piece from his "Re-Klein" series of works.
